7A COLLATON 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Torbay local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 7A COLLATON ROAD sales from June 1999 and March 2001 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the June 1999 sale was for 24%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 24% below the HPI over time, until the March 2001 sale, where it rises to 1%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 1% above the HPI.

What might 7A COLLATON ROAD be worth now?

7A COLLATON ROAD might now be worth an estimated £440,725.

This is based on house price inflation of 203.9%, between March 2001 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Torbay local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 203.9%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 7A COLLATON ROAD of £145,000 on 23rd March 2001. For the value to have increased from £145,000 to £440,725 over the 24 years and one month to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 7A COLLATON 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Torbay local authority area.
  • The March 2001 sale price of £145,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 7A COLLATON ROAD has not materially changed since March 2001.

7A COLLATON ROAD: Plot and Title Map

7A COLLATON 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.070 of an acre, or 283m². The below map shows the location of 7A COLLATON 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 7A COLLATON 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
